Sweeten Your Easter Designs with Cookies for Easter

When a design project calls for a dose of pure, unadulterated charm, you need a typeface that delivers instant personality. Enter Cookies for Easter, a premium font that feels less like a digital file and more like a freshly baked treat. This isn't your standard, run-of-the-mill typeface. It's a full-color SVG font, meaning each letter is a tiny, high-resolution image of a crispy cookie slathered in pastel frosting and topped with colorful sprinkles. The result is a typeface that brings a tactile, playful, and visually rich element to any project it touches.

A Typeface That Tastes Like Celebration

The visual appeal of Cookies for Easter is immediate and potent. It’s a masterclass in whimsical design, perfect for capturing the festive spirit of spring and Easter celebrations. Each character maintains a consistent, handcrafted feel, yet the alternate glyph options—which you can access through your system's character map or a program like Silhouette Studio—prevent any sense of repetition. You can cycle through different colors for each letter, giving you incredible creative control over your final composition. This level of detail makes it a standout creative font for designers who appreciate nuance and playful interaction in their typography.

As a display font, its purpose is singular: to grab attention and set a specific mood. It’s not designed for body text in a long-form article, but rather for headlines, titles, logos, and short, impactful phrases. Think of it as the decorative icing on your design cake. Its personality is festive, youthful, and celebratory, making it an ideal choice for projects targeting families, children, or anyone with a sweet tooth for nostalgia. The style is a unique blend of a handwritten font and a script font, but with the added dimension of realistic texture and color that traditional vector fonts simply cannot offer.

Practical Guidance for Using a Color Font

Adopting a specialized font like Cookies for Easter into your workflow requires a bit of practical knowledge. While it’s installed like any standard .otf font (via FontBook on Mac or the Control Panel on Windows), its behavior is unique.

A key thing to remember is that color fonts will show as black in non-compatible programs. You might see the cookie shape, but the pastel frosting and sprinkles will be a solid silhouette. Even in programs that do support them, like Adobe Illustrator, Silhouette Studio, Quark, and Inkscape, the font often appears black in the font selection preview window. The magic happens only when you type it out on your canvas. If you see the full-color letters, you’re good to go. This compatibility is crucial for maintaining the intended brand identity and visual appeal across different platforms.

When considering this commercial font for a project, think about font pairing. Because Cookies for Easter is so visually dominant, it pairs best with simple, clean companions. A neutral sans serif font for subheadings or a basic serif font for any supporting text will create balance and ensure your design remains professional. Avoid pairing it with other decorative or script fonts, as this will create visual clutter and harm readability.

Evaluating its fit for a project is straightforward. Ask yourself: does the project’s tone align with a playful, festive, and handcrafted aesthetic? If the goal is to evoke feelings of joy, celebration, and whimsy, Cookies for Easter is an excellent choice. If the project demands a serious, corporate, or minimalist tone, you should look elsewhere. Always test the font in your specific design software to confirm it renders correctly and to explore the alternate glyphs. This testing phase is key to unlocking its full creative potential and ensuring your final design is as delightful as the font itself.
